Problem of the Study:

Today, health systems are undergoing a significant transformation driven by digitalization and artificial intelligence-based technologies. Whether this transformation occurs homogeneously across countries in terms of artificial intelligence-related investments constitutes a fundamental research problem.

Purpose of the Study:

The aim of this study is to examine the trends in artificial intelligence investments in the health sector within the framework of OECD data and to evaluate these investments from a health economics perspective, providing an assessment of how they differ according to countries’ levels of economic development.

Method:

This study utilizes secondary data obtained from the OECD Artificial Intelligence Database and relevant international reports. The analysis covers artificial intelligence venture capital investments for the period 2012–2025 and examines sectoral distribution in the health sector, specifically including healthcare, pharmaceuticals, and biotechnology. The study evaluates the development of AI investments through time-trend analysis and comparative sectoral analysis.

Results:

The findings indicate a significant increase in artificial intelligence investments after 2010, particularly accelerated by the COVID-19 pandemic. The health sector is one of the main areas where AI investments are concentrated, with notable developments in healthcare services, pharmaceutical development, and biotechnology applications. However, when Turkey’s data is examined, venture capital investments in healthcare-related artificial intelligence remain significantly limited compared to global levels, suggesting the need for increased national investment.

Conclusions:

There are significant differences among countries with different levels of economic development in terms of the level, distribution, and effectiveness of artificial intelligence investments. Although AI investments have the potential to transform health systems, realizing this potential requires appropriate policy frameworks, infrastructure investments, and the development of human capital. The findings for Turkey indicate that investments in health-related artificial intelligence remain limited compared to global trends. Therefore, in light of factors affecting AI investments and their relationship with countries’ development levels, policymakers should strengthen the investment ecosystem and implement legal and institutional reforms to ensure a more secure and predictable investment environment.
